Yasmim Ângela Feitosa de Souza, a popular social-media personality known for her lifestyle and cooking content, died on November 12, 2025, at the age of 26 just two days after celebrating her birthday in Petrolina, Brazil.
According to her mother, Yasmim had spent the day of her 26th birthday in high spirits. She ran errands, shopped with her mother and appeared healthy, before later sharing alcohol with two friends in the evening. The trio consumed approximately 1.5 litres of whiskey, according to the family, and Yasmim began feeling ill later that night. By the next day she had died at home, prompting an investigation into possible toxic alcohol ingestion.
Hospital records at the University Hospital of Univasf in the region indicated that they received a patient with symptoms consistent with methanol poisoning. The bottle of whiskey consumed is reportedly under analysis by authorities as part of the ongoing investigation.
Yasmim had cultivated a social-media presence of more than 23,000 Instagram followers, where she shared lifestyle photos, cooking videos and posts with her fiancé. Her final Instagram update was on November 5 and featured a screenshot of a message exchange with her partner, whose engagement she revealed in October with a post celebrating “our forever”.
Her sudden passing has shocked her followers and raised concerns about the dangers of tainted alcohol in Brazil a country that has seen multiple fatalities linked to illegally produced spirits and poisoning outbreaks. The incident underscores the risks faced in informal drinking scenarios and the tragic consequences that can follow.
In her tribute, Yasmim’s mother described the ordeal with heartbreak. She recalled her daughter laughing and enjoying the birthday outing then becoming ill “at night” and being unable to save her. The family has asked for privacy as investigations continue and funeral preparations are made for her burial on November 13.
